#148712 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#148712 is composed of 7.8% red, 52.9%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.7%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 119 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 30%. #148712 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ff24 with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#148712 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#148712 has RGB values of R:20, G:135,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 1345298.

Shades and Tints of #148712
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e02 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#148712
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#475247 is the less saturated color, while #039900 is the most saturated one.
